Founder & Executive Director

Prior to founding Concrete Safaris, Sharon Levine, known as Ms. Mac, volunteered her time over 12 years with youth via nonprofit organizations, such as Coalition for the Homeless of Central Florida and Free Arts NYC. She is a graduate of the National Outdoor Leadership School (NOLS) and is a certified Wilderness First Responder, Exercise & Lifestyle Coach, Master Composter, and Leave No Trace Trainer. Mac is an avid writer with fitness articles, adventure essays, and photos published in magazines, such as Billboard and Bust. She has been featured in Allure, Jane, The New York Times, ReadyMade, SELF, Shape, and USA Today. She has also appeared as a panelist on SundanceChannel.com and as a guest speaker at Stern School of Business’ Social Enterprise Association at NYU and YouthBridge-NY’s Leaders-to-Leaders Youth Summit. Mac graduated cum laude from Northeastern University. Presently, she is a Masters candidate at Columbia University’s Mailman School of Public Health. When she’s not gardening, hiking, and service-learning with CS Explorers, Mac can be found hiking with her dog, Zeppy, skating or cycling city streets and greenways, paddling, and drinking lots of water.
